Role Summary
Join the Silicon One development organization as an ASIC Design-For-Test (DFT) Engineer. You will collaborate with front-end RTL teams and backend physical-design teams to define and implement DFT requirements early in the design cycle and drive testability from implementation through post-silicon validation.
The role is on the Common Hardware Group (CHG) team focused on network silicon platforms; responsibilities include DFT IP development, full-chip integration, and supporting physical-design signoff and post-silicon debug.

Responsibilities
Primary responsibilities include technical ownership of DFT features and coordination across design and validation phases.
- Implement hardware DFT features to support ATE, in-system test, debug and diagnostics.
- Develop and integrate DFT IP in collaboration with RTL, verification, and physical-design teams.
- Enable integration and validation of test logic throughout implementation and post-silicon flows.
- Contribute to DFT and physical-design aspects for new device models (bare die and stacked die).
- Drive reusable test and debug strategies and participate in test/timing signoff activities.
- Lead DFT quality processes and perform debug with minimal mentorship.
Requirements
Technical must-haves and recommended skills.
Must-have:
- Extensive experience in DFT, test, and silicon engineering (7+ years).
- Experience with JTAG protocols, scan methodologies, BIST architectures (including memory BIST and boundary scan).
- Experience with ATPG and EDA tools such as TestMax, Tetramax, Tessent tool sets, and PrimeTime.
- Gate-level simulation and debugging experience (e.g., VCS or similar simulators).
- Post-silicon validation and debug experience, including working with ATE patterns and P1687.
- Ability to design solutions and perform debug with minimal supervision.
Nice-to-have:
- Verilog design experience for custom DFT logic and IP integration; familiarity with functional verification.
- DFT CAD development experience: test architecture, methodology and infrastructure.
- Test static timing analysis and system-verilog logic equivalency/checking for test timing validation.
